Pupils at Magdalen College School are celebrating an excellent set of A Level and Pre-U results. The school is delighted to report that 97% of grades were awarded at A*-B, with 85% at A*-A and 46% at A*. In addition, 47 pupils – 30% of the year group – attained 3 A*s or more and 21 pupils achieved 4 A*s or more.

Pupils will be heading to some of the UK’s top universities including Oxford, Cambridge, LSE, St Andrews and Bath to read subjects ranging from Medicine to English and Chemical Engineering to Spanish. 38 pupils will be taking up places at Oxbridge.
